Snajder Takes Second in Pentathlon at ECACsPublished by
This Friday marked the first day of the 2014 ECAC Championships, hosted by Boston University. Senior captain Amanda Snajder took to the track in the pentathlon, the event in which she holds the school record. Though she was the only Bulldog competing, Snajder did not let that stop her from taking second out of fifteen competitors, racking up 3569 points. The pentathlon is comprised of five events: the 60-meter hurdles, high jump, shot put, long jump, and 800-meter run. Snajder s best finish came in the high jump, where she placed third. However, her performance was strong across the board, with top-five finishes in the 60-meter hurdles and long jump, and top-10 finishes in the 800-meter run and shot put.
